Costa Rica competed in the 2019 Pan American Games in Lima, Peru from July 26——to August 11, "2019."

On 11 July 2019, the Costa Rican Olympic Committee officially named a team of 85 athletes (44 women and 41 men) competing in 24 sports.

During the opening ceremony of the "games," footballer Shirley Cruz carried the flag of the country as part of the parade of nations.

At this edition of the games, "Costa Rica won five medals," the second best performance for the country at a single edition of the games (the best performance being the 11 medals won in 1987).
